==Environment and decarbonization== Oslo is a [[compact city]]. It is easy to move around by public transportation and rentable city bikes accessible to all in many places in the city centre. In 2003, Oslo received The European Sustainable City Award and in 2007 Reader's Digest ranked Oslo as number two on a list of the world's greenest, most livable cities.<ref>{{cite web |author=polymorphing |url=http://sustainable-cities.eu/Sustainable-Cities-Awards-101-2-3-.html |title=Sustainable Cities And Towns Campaign |publisher=Sustainable-cities.eu |access-date=21 June 2010 |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20110501174310/http://sustainable-cities.eu/Sustainable-Cities-Awards-101-2-3-.html |archive-date=1 May 2011}}</ref><ref>{{cite web |last=Kahn |first=Matthew |url=http://www.readersdigest.com.au/green-best-and-worst-countries |title=Living Green: Ranking the best (and worst) countries |publisher=Reader's Digest Australia |access-date=21 June 2010 |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20101220130426/http://readersdigest.com.au/green-best-and-worst-countries |archive-date=20 December 2010 }}</ref> The City of Oslo has set the goal of becoming a low carbon city, and reducing [[Greenhouse gas|greenhouse gas emissions]] 95% from 1990 levels by 2030.<ref>{{cite web |url=https://www.oslo.kommune.no/politics-and-administration/green-oslo/best-practices/oslo-s-climate-strategy-and-climate-budget/ |title=Oslo's climate strategy and climate budget |website=Oslo kommune |language=en |access-date=28 December 2019 |archive-date=28 December 2019 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20191228193131/https://www.oslo.kommune.no/politics-and-administration/green-oslo/best-practices/oslo-s-climate-strategy-and-climate-budget/ |url-status=dead }}</ref> The climate action plan for the Port of Oslo includes implementing a low-carbon contracting process, and installing [[Shorepower|shore power]] for vessels which are docked.<ref>{{cite web |url=https://www.klimaoslo.no/wp-content/uploads/sites/88/2019/03/Action-Plan-Port-of-Oslo-as-a-zero-emission-port.pdf |title=Port of Oslo as a Zero Emission Port: Action Plan |author=((Department of Business Development and Public Ownership, Oslo kommune)) |date=June 2019 |website=KlimaOslo |access-date=28 December 2019 |archive-date=14 December 2019 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20191214064144/https://www.klimaoslo.no/wp-content/uploads/sites/88/2019/03/Action-Plan-Port-of-Oslo-as-a-zero-emission-port.pdf |url-status=dead }}</ref><ref>{{cite news |url=https://www.citylab.com/environment/2019/11/oslo-port-shipping-emissions-climate-plan-electric-ferries/601378/ |title=Oslo's Ambitious Plan to Decarbonize Its Port |last=Lindeman |first=Tracey |date=8 November 2019 |newspaper=Bloomberg.com |language=en |access-date=28 December 2019 |archive-date=28 December 2019 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20191228193126/https://www.citylab.com/environment/2019/11/oslo-port-shipping-emissions-climate-plan-electric-ferries/601378/ |url-status=live}}</ref> By October 2022, Oslo had an extensive network of bicycle lanes and tram lines, most of its ferry boats had been electrified, and the city was "on course to become the first capital city in the world with an all-electric public transport system", including e-buses.<ref>{{Cite web |last=Symons |first=Angela |date=14 October 2022 |title=Oslo set to become first capital with zero-emissions public transport |url=https://www.euronews.com/green/2022/10/14/zero-emissions-public-transport-network-could-be-a-reality-in-oslo-by-end-of-2023 |access-date=1 November 2022 |website=euronews |language=en |archive-date=1 November 2022 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20221101045204/https://www.euronews.com/green/2022/10/14/zero-emissions-public-transport-network-could-be-a-reality-in-oslo-by-end-of-2023 |url-status=live }}</ref>
